WebThe world's largest bioluminescent vertebrate is the kitefin shark (Dalatias lichaFrontiers in Marine Science in February 2024. The emitted light is blue-green in colour, with a wavelength of 455–486 nanometres, and its emission, from specialized skin cells called photocytes, is hormonally controlled, being triggered by melatonin.
